This short article looks into the numerous elements of UPVC windows and doors, exploring their advantages, costs, maintenance, and regularly asked questions.<br>What is UPVC?<br>UPVC is a type of plastic that is commonly utilized in the building market, especially for window and door frames. Unlike regular PVC, UPVC does not contain plasticizers, that makes it rigid and suitable for structural applications. The product is resistant to moisture and ecological deterioration, giving it a longer life-span compared to standard materials like wood and metal.<br>Advantages of UPVC Windows and Doors<br>Sturdiness: UPVC is highly resistant to rot, rust, and fading, making it an excellent option for climates with severe climate condition.<br><br>Energy Efficiency: UPVC frames can assist enhance the energy efficiency of homes.
